Big B greets fans on year ahead

Darpan News Desk IANS, 13 Nov, 2015 08:52 PM
  • Big B greets fans on year ahead
Megastar Amitabh Bachchan greeted his fans on the year ahead and has hoped it brings happiness in everybody's life.
 
"The new year (sic) begins for all and may this bring the sparkle of the lights and the happiness and the joys that the next generation shall and does invest in," Amitabh posted on his blog on Friday.
 
The "Piku" star also posted a photograph of his family where besides him, his wife Jaya, son Abhishek, daughter-in-law Aishwarya and grandaughter Aaradhya can be seen celebrating Diwali.
 
He wrote: "Life works till now and life felicitates till the dawn on another 'floor’...but the moment of the day shall always rest with the ‘little one’ who’s divine presence makes up for the flaws that one may or can imagine.”
 
On film front, the 73-year-old will next be seen in “Wazir”.
